Output 63d45a88cc5fac28d82f0e03c4cf6beca1f3993aacd3ea3337f8c86179375a4a:3

value
8666391
script pubkey
OP_0 OP_PUSHBYTES_32 d8083acff4acfc463440f08c9fb34ef76daa64850cc2070ca16b532f81d5d6d4
address
bc1qmqyr4nl54n7yvdzq7zxflv6w7ak65ey9pnpqwr9pddfjlqw46m2q88rr30
transaction
63d45a88cc5fac28d82f0e03c4cf6beca1f3993aacd3ea3337f8c86179375a4a
spent
true